Sorts Of Finishes Available for Wood Floors
When redecorating wood floors, homeowners can pick from numerous sorts of surfaces that greatly influence the flooring's look and resilience. Oil-based polyurethane alternatives are understood for their rich color and long-lasting protection, while water-based finishes provide a quicker drying out time and lower ecological influence. Recognizing these choices is vital for attaining the preferred appearance and efficiency of wood floors.
Oil-Based Polyurethane Alternatives
Oil-based polyurethane choices are preferred selections for refinishing wood floorings because of their sturdiness and abundant finish. These coatings give a durable protective layer that boosts the timber's all-natural beauty while standing up to scrapes and wear. Readily available in numerous luster degrees, including matte, satin, and glossy, oil-based polyurethanes allow home owners to pick a look that complements their interior design. The application procedure generally involves fining sand the flooring to ensure proper adhesion, adhered to by several layers of polyurethane. Oil-based finishes take longer to dry and discharge stronger odors throughout application, their durability makes them a popular choice. Additionally, they are understood for their capacity to deepen the shade of the wood over time, developing a cozy, welcoming look.
Water-Based Finishing Selections
Water-based coatings use an exceptional option for refinishing wood floorings, giving a quick-drying alternative that lessens smell throughout application. These coatings typically have less unpredictable natural substances (VOCs), making them a more eco-friendly selection. Readily available in various sheens, consisting of matte, satin, and gloss, water-based surfaces enable flexibility in achieving the desired visual. They penetrate the timber surface area efficiently, improving the natural grain without modifying its color substantially. Additionally, water-based finishes tend to be a lot more immune to yellowing over time compared to oil-based choices. They may need even more regular reapplication due to their lower durability under hefty foot traffic. Generally, water-based finishes are suitable for house owners seeking a fast, low-odor redecorating option.
Assessing the Problem of Your Floorings
Just how can home owners figure out if their wood floorings want redecorating? The evaluation begins with a visual examination. Homeowners should try to find signs of wear, such as scrapes, damages, and staining. A floor that appears boring or does not have radiance may additionally indicate that refinishing is essential. In addition, home owners can execute the water test: a few declines of water should grain externally; if it saturates in, the coating may be compromised.Sound can also be an indication; creaking or standing out sounds when walking on the flooring may suggest much deeper issues. Additionally, house owners need to take into consideration the age of the coating; usually, timber floors call for refinishing every 7 to one decade, depending on website traffic and upkeep. On the whole, a complete analysis will help figure out when it's time to involve a redecorating service to restore the appeal of the timber floors.
The Wood Flooring Refinishing Refine Explained
The wood flooring redecorating procedure includes a number of essential actions to bring back the appeal of hardwood surfaces. Detailed preparation and cleansing are essential to guarantee suitable results. Following this, fining sand and finishing techniques are related to boost the flooring's look and longevity.
Preparation and Cleansing Tips
Preparing a timber floor for redecorating requires a thorough approach to assure optimal outcomes. The primary step entails clearing the location of furniture and rugs, ensuring a roomy work atmosphere. Next off, a complete cleansing is necessary; using a vacuum or broom to get rid of dirt and particles assists avoid scrapes during the redecorating procedure. Following this, a damp wipe can be used to get rid of any type of remaining gunk, enabling the flooring to completely dry totally. Checking the surface area for problems, such as cracks or loosened boards, is crucial, as these problems need to be addressed prior to redecorating begins. Ensuring appropriate air flow in the area will aid assist in a smoother refinishing procedure, eventually leading to a wonderfully recovered wood flooring.
Fining Sand and Ending Up Techniques
Fining sand is a crucial action in the timber floor redecorating process that recovers the surface area to its original radiance. This technique removes old finishes, scratches, and imperfections, developing a smooth base for new layers. Usually, a drum sander is made use of for big locations, while side sanders take on edges and complex areas. Several grits of sandpaper are utilized, beginning with coarse grit and progressing to finer selections, guaranteeing a sleek finish.After sanding, the flooring is completely vacuumed and cleaned to get rid of dust. The completing procedure complies web with, which includes applying sealants or discolorations to improve shade and shield the wood. Numerous completing options, such as water-based or oil-based surfaces, provide different appearances and toughness, catering to diverse preferences and demands.
Estimated Prices and Budgeting for Redecorating
While preparing a timber flooring refinishing task, homeowners frequently locate themselves pondering the approximated costs entailed. The overall expense for redecorating wood floorings usually varies from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on various aspects such as the dimension of the location, the kind of wood, and the selected coating. For a typical room of 300 square feet, this can suggest a spending plan of about $900 to $2,400. House owners should also think about added costs, including furnishings removal, repair services to the wood, and possible examinations with professionals. If going with DIY approaches, expenses for fining sand devices and completing items need to be factored in too. To avoid shocks, it is suggested to acquire numerous quotes from local service providers and develop a detailed spending plan that incorporates all prospective expenses. This positive approach warranties economic preparedness and sets practical assumptions for the refinishing task.
Tips for Keeping Your Freshly Redecorated Floors
Normal maintenance is essential for maintaining the appeal and longevity of newly redecorated timber floorings. House owners should establish a cleaning routine that includes sweeping or vacuuming to eliminate dirt and particles, which can scratch the surface. Utilizing a wet mop with a pH-balanced cleaner specifically created for wood floorings is advised, staying clear of excessive moisture that can harm the finish.To avoid wear, positioning felt pads under furniture legs is important. When relocating items, this lowers the danger of scratches. Furthermore, rug can be purposefully positioned in high-traffic areas to supply extra protection.Humidity visit our website levels should be monitored, as timber expands and contracts with changes in dampness. Maintaining a steady indoor environment can help avoid warping. Finally, avoiding shoes with hard soles and promptly cleaning up spills will certainly even more protect the floor's stability, ensuring it remains a magnificent function of the home for many years to find.
